Zh变换及其在视频对象形状编码中的应用研究

Zh-Transform and Its Application in Video Object Shape Coding

摘要 为了提高基于位图的形状编码方法的可扩展性 ,提出一种能够用于二值位图的图像变换———Zh变换 表示视频对象形状的二值位图经过Zh变换以后 ,被分解为一些较小的位图 这些小位图从粗到精地描述了原来视频对象的形状 在Zh变换的基础上 ,结合基于上下文的算术编码 ,提出一种视频对象形状编码方法 实验结果证明 ,该方法不仅具有很好的空间和信噪比可扩展性 ,而且在编码效率上也明显高于MPEG In order to improve the scalability of bitmap based shape coding methods, a new transform called Zh transform is presented to deal with binary bitmap After Zh transform, the original bitmap representing the shape of video object is decomposed into several small bitmaps These small bitmaps describe the shape from rough glancing to fine detailing Based on Zh transform and context based arithmetic encoding, a new shape coding method is formulated Experiment results show that the new method not only has good spatial and SNR scalability but also has much higher coding efficiency than the MPEG 4 first edition
